Keynote title: Beyond the Platform's Algorithmic Power: Constructing Trust, Control, and Capitol in Worker-Platform, Worker-Client, and Worker-Worker Communicative Relationships.
The controls wielded by crowdwork platforms via algorithmic power and the resulting precarious conditions that these facilitate has been emphasized by scholarly research over recent years. This is matched by theorizing that captures the expressions of agency, resistance and collective organization among workers in ways that simultaneously challenge and reinforce some of these platform controls. One of the understudied aspects in the exploration of platform workers’ lived conditions amid dialectical power relations pertains to workers’ communicative relationships with their clients and other workers. Although the platform’s power emerges in the techno-social control it wields in the trilateral relationship of platform, workers, and clients, the situated intercultural relationships between workers (often based in the Global South) and their clients (often based in the Global North) and the interpersonal relationships between workers shape a significant dimension of the platform labor conditions and experience.
